Description from the publisher:

In response to need to introduce the Islam by means of translation of the meanings of the Holy Quran, Dr. Muhammad Taqi-ud-Din Al-Hilali and Dr. Muhammad Muhsin Khan accomplished the interpretation of the meanings of the Holy Quran into the English language, by referring the most authentic Tafsirs like Al-Tabari, Al-Qurtubi, Ibn Kathir, and Sahih al-Bukhari.

Preface:

All praises and thanks be to Allah, the Lord of ‘Alamin (Mankind, Jinns and all that exists) and peace be upon the Master of the Messengers, Muhammad (p.b.u.h.).

This interpretation of the meanings of the Noble Quran has been revised and the following changes have been made:

1) Each verse has been put separately with its English interpretation.2) The Arabic text of the Noble Quran has be taken from Mushaf Al-Madina An-Nabawiyya which has been printed by the Mujamma’ of King Fahd of Saudi Arabia for the printing of Al-Mushaf Ash-Sharif in the year 1405 A.H. according to the instructions of the Chancellor of the Islamic University, instead of the old Arabic text of the previous print of this book which was printed in the United States and Turkey by the Turkish Calligrapher Sheikh Hamid Al-Amadi.3) There are some additions and subtractions of Chapters and Hadiths from Shahih Al-Bukhari, etc.4) Some additions, corrections, and alterations have been made to improve the English translation and to bring the English interpretation very close to the correct and exact meanings of the Arabic text.5) As regards the old Edition of this Book, nobody is allowed to reprint or to reproduce it after this new Edition has been published.6) This new Edition is in two forms – one in a detailed form (in 9 volumes), and the other in a summarized form (in volume).

3 Rajab, 1405 A.H. – March 23, 1985

TranslatorsDr. Muhammad Taqi-ud-Din Al-HilaliDr. Muhammad Muhsin Khan
